  • Title

    Empirical modeling of proton induced SEU rates

  • Abstract
    A new method for calculating proton induced SEU (p-SEU) rates in orbit from heavy ion cross section data is presented. It is based on a simple expression to derive the p-SET cross section from the heavy ion results which leads to an `effective LET flux´ for the protons in the given orbit. The resulted p-SEU rates are in good agreement with those calculated from measured p-SEU cross section data. A comparison with other empirical models is given
